设计数据库需要什么工具

fiy 其他 1

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    设计数据库需要以下工具:

    1. 数据库管理系统(DBMS):数据库管理系统是设计和管理数据库的关键工具。常见的DBMS包括MySQL、Oracle、SQL Server等。选择适合项目需求的DBMS是设计数据库的首要步骤。

    2. 数据建模工具:数据建模是数据库设计的关键步骤,它用于定义数据库的结构和关系。数据建模工具帮助开发人员可视化数据库的结构,常见的数据建模工具包括Erwin、PowerDesigner等。

    3. SQL编辑器:SQL编辑器是用于编写和执行SQL语句的工具。它提供了语法高亮、自动完成等功能,帮助开发人员更轻松地编写和调试SQL语句。常见的SQL编辑器包括Toad、SQL Developer等。

    4. 数据库设计工具:数据库设计工具是用于设计和管理数据库的工具。它们提供了可视化界面,帮助开发人员创建表、定义字段和关系等。常见的数据库设计工具包括MySQL Workbench、Oracle SQL Developer Data Modeler等。

    5. 数据库性能监控工具:数据库性能监控工具用于监控数据库的性能指标,如CPU利用率、内存使用量、磁盘IO等。它们帮助开发人员及时发现和解决数据库性能问题,提高系统的响应速度和可靠性。常见的数据库性能监控工具包括Nagios、Zabbix等。

    6. 数据库备份和恢复工具:数据库备份和恢复工具用于定期备份数据库,并在需要时恢复数据库。它们提供了自动化的备份和恢复功能,帮助开发人员保护数据的安全性和完整性。常见的数据库备份和恢复工具包括MySQL Enterprise Backup、Oracle Recovery Manager等。

    设计数据库时,以上工具可以帮助开发人员进行数据建模、SQL编写、数据库设计、性能监控以及备份和恢复等工作,提高数据库的效率和可靠性。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    设计数据库需要使用以下工具:

    1. 数据建模工具:数据建模工具用于绘制数据库模型图,帮助开发人员可视化数据库结构。常见的数据建模工具包括ERwin、PowerDesigner、MySQL Workbench等。这些工具提供了丰富的功能,如实体关系图绘制、属性定义、约束条件设置等。

    2. 数据库管理系统(DBMS):数据库管理系统是用于创建、操作和管理数据库的软件。常见的DBMS包括Oracle、MySQL、SQL Server等。通过DBMS,可以创建数据库、定义表、插入、更新和删除数据等。

    3. SQL编辑器:SQL编辑器用于编写和执行SQL语句。SQL语句用于创建表、定义约束、插入、更新和删除数据等操作。常见的SQL编辑器包括SQL Server Management Studio、MySQL Workbench、Navicat等。

    4. 数据库版本控制工具:数据库版本控制工具用于管理数据库的版本和变更。它可以追踪数据库的修改历史,帮助开发人员在不同环境中进行数据库的部署和回滚。常见的数据库版本控制工具包括Git、SVN等。

    5. 数据库性能分析工具:数据库性能分析工具用于监测和分析数据库的性能。它可以帮助开发人员识别慢查询、瓶颈和优化机会。常见的数据库性能分析工具包括MySQL Performance Schema、Oracle Enterprise Manager等。

    6. 数据库安全工具:数据库安全工具用于保护数据库中的数据安全。它可以帮助开发人员识别潜在的安全风险、加密敏感数据、实施访问控制等。常见的数据库安全工具包括MySQL Enterprise Firewall、Oracle Advanced Security等。

    通过使用以上工具,开发人员可以更高效地设计数据库,并确保数据库的稳定性、安全性和性能。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在设计数据库时,有许多工具可供选择。这些工具可以帮助数据库设计师创建、管理和维护数据库。以下是一些常用的数据库设计工具:

    1. MySQL Workbench:MySQL Workbench是一个用于MySQL数据库的集成开发环境(IDE)。它提供了一套丰富的工具,用于设计、开发和管理MySQL数据库。它支持可视化建模,可以通过拖放和绘图的方式设计数据库结构。

    2. Microsoft SQL Server Management Studio:Microsoft SQL Server Management Studio(SSMS)是一个用于管理和开发Microsoft SQL Server数据库的集成开发环境(IDE)。它提供了丰富的功能,包括数据库设计、查询和脚本编写等。SSMS支持可视化建模,可以通过拖放和绘图的方式设计数据库结构。

    3. Oracle SQL Developer:Oracle SQL Developer是一个针对Oracle数据库的集成开发环境(IDE)。它提供了一套丰富的工具,用于设计、开发和管理Oracle数据库。它支持可视化建模,可以通过拖放和绘图的方式设计数据库结构。

    4. ER/Studio Data Architect:ER/Studio Data Architect是一款功能强大的数据库设计工具,支持多个数据库平台。它提供了丰富的功能,包括可视化建模、数据字典管理、数据流分析等。它还支持与其他建模工具和开发工具的集成。

    5. PowerDesigner:PowerDesigner是一款功能强大的数据库设计和建模工具。它支持多个数据库平台,并提供了丰富的功能,包括可视化建模、数据字典管理、数据流分析等。它还支持与其他建模工具和开发工具的集成。

    6. Lucidchart:Lucidchart是一个在线的图表绘制工具,可以用于设计数据库结构。它提供了丰富的数据库建模符号和模板,可以通过拖放和绘图的方式设计数据库结构。它还支持与其他建模工具和开发工具的集成。

    7. Visual Paradigm:Visual Paradigm是一个功能强大的建模工具,支持多个数据库平台。它提供了丰富的功能,包括可视化建模、数据字典管理、数据流分析等。它还支持与其他建模工具和开发工具的集成。

    这些工具各有特点,选择合适的工具取决于个人需求和偏好。在选择工具时,需要考虑数据库平台的兼容性、功能需求、易用性以及与其他工具的集成性等因素。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部